    FFXIV on Mac and Steam account linking

    My account type is Steam because I started playing this game on Windows. However, I since switched to Mac and have been playing this game for years using the Mac version. FFXIV is not available on Steam on the Mac. The recent changes described here would mean that I'd have to launch FFXIV through Steam, making it inoperable on the Mac. In addition, I wouldn't be able to switch to PS5 at my leisure since it is also incompatible. Why is Square Enix doing this and what is the remedy? Does Square Enix mean to prohibit cross-platform players who have Steam-type accounts, or is the announcement just poorly-worded?

    This is what I mean by cross-platform players for Steam account holders. I have three platforms that I can play the game on, but only one of them run Steam.

    Account type is Standard (Steam). I uploaded a screenshot that shows it. There are two account types, Standard and Standard (Steam). All three platforms are available under each. Buying the game on a different platform doesn’t change your account type. The announcement suggests that Steam account holders can only log in via PC barring the other two platforms. There isn’t yet a mechanism to switch account types or transfer characters.

    It's not going to affect the PS and Mac versions of the game. Your account type is standard (steam), because your windows license is locked to Steam and that's just how SE chooses to display it.

    The game has checked if the game is a steam version for a long time already (tho it's been easy to bypass, if you wanted to play SE store version with a steam license). What SE is going to be doing now is also checking for the steam ID used to launch the game.

    Why would you have to? The only thing that is changing is that when you launch the game via Steam, details about the Steam account being used to launch the game are sent to the game servers. If the sent data does not match what SE has registered, the login is refused.

    What happens right now with steam version is:
    - You launch the game via Steam
    - The launcher starts with an extra argument that tells the program that it was launched via Steam
    - When the client is started, the same steam argument is given to it
    - When you login to datacenter, if the -issteam argument is present, the game will ask for service accounts that have a Windows (Steam) license attached to them. If it doesn't find one, because for example, your Windows copy is not the Steam version, you will get an error.
    - If the -issteam argument is not present, the game will ask for service accounts that have a non-Steam Windows license attached to them. If it doesn't find one, because for example, your Windows copy is the Steam version, you will get an error.

    As a result, it is impossible to launch the game via Steam, if you have a non-Steam Windows copy. In theory, it is also not possible to launch the game without doing so via Steam, if you have a Steam copy, but this has so far been trivial to bypass by starting the launcher by manually adding the -issteam argument when executing the launcher.

    What SE is gonna do is that when the game is launched via Steam, some Steam token is also sent to the launcher and passed to the server on login. If this token is not what it should be (the Steam account used to buy the game), the server will not allow the login to proceed.

    This has nothing to do with 6.1 housing. What it does is make it impossible to login to the PC version if you are not logged in to the buyer's Steam account, if your PC version is the Steam version. It has no effect on other platforms or the non-Steam Windows version.

    If you have the Steam version of the game and you fell for one of the giveaway scams etc. the scammer will not be able to login to your character with just your SE account details, they need your Steam details too. Sure, they will start asking for those too, but it increases suspicion and people are less likely to fall for it. They could also still login on PS or Mac, if you have the license, but that's not how these scammers operate, it's just too slow.
